Not quite sure if this should go in this forum but...I am really enjoying my goat but there is one thing that is bugging me a bit about the model... mostly it is the tail(and the way the front legs bend oddly when it runs). I can't seem to think of my goat as a goat because of its tail. A goat's tail is turned up while a sheep's tail flops down. I almost feel like the model needs a short turned up tail. What do you guys think?
